Is a Boat Accident Legal?

It is possible, depending on the severity of your injury, to claim both long-term and immediate expenses for medical care in your lawsuit. You could also be able to recover lost income in the event that your injuries keep you from working in the future.

You can also seek compensation for other damages, like emotional distress and pain and suffering. There are a variety of steps you must take to be able to successfully file a legal claim for a boating accident.

Reporting the accident

The first thing one must do following an injury during a boating accident is to notify the police or the department that is responsible for boating regulations. In many states this is a mandatory requirement. It is crucial to collect valuable information regarding what caused the accident.

There are a myriad of factors that can lead to accidents on boats, and it is important for victims to report their accidents immediately to ensure that the most important details are recorded. This could prove that a boater was negligent and should be held accountable for the injuries sustained by the victim.

According to New York State Law seymour boat accident law firm accidents should be reported when a person is killed or injured when a person departs the boat in circumstances that suggest death, or if damage to the equipment or boat that exceeds $2,000 The accident report is used by the families of victims who have been injured and those who have suffered to show that the other party was negligent.

Those who are injured in a boating accident should consult their physician and keep a record of all medical expenses related to the incident. These may include ambulance costs, emergency room fees hospital expenses, doctor visits, physical therapy, medical fees and other expenses. Victims could also be entitled to compensation for future and past medical expenses, as for pain and suffering and lost wages as well as emotional distress.

Gathering Evidence

A boating accident, regardless of whether it takes place on a river, lake or ocean, can result in life-altering injuries that require costly medical treatment and career changes. Fortunately, just as car accident victims have the right to pursue compensation from those who cause accidents, you have the right to do similarly if you are afflicted with injuries due to someone else's boating recklessness or negligence.

After making sure that you and your passengers are safe, it is important to capture photos of the scene of the accident the damage, injuries, and any other physical evidence that may be useful. It is also essential to obtain the names and contact information of witnesses.

A New York duarte boat accident law firm accident attorney can utilize this information in order to determine who is accountable for the accident and what injuries you have suffered. In some instances it is possible to call in expert witnesses who can provide their opinions on the basis of their experience. This may include accident reconstruction experts medical professionals, doctors, and other experts in the field.

A lawyer can also investigate whether the mechanical system of the boat was defective or malfunctioning, and contributing to your injuries or accident. A New York boat accident lawyer may pursue compensation if the mechanical system fails. If the accident resulted from a mistake in judgment, an attorney may seek compensation from either the person who was responsible for the error or from the boat's owner.

Making a Claim

A boat accident could be more complicated than a car crash, which is why it's crucial to seek legal advice. An experienced attorney from Shuman Legal can handle the details of your case and ensure you get the money you are entitled to.

In some cases the victims of an accident on the water may have to file a suit against the person responsible. A personal injury claim may aid in remunerating a victim for medical costs, lost wages and other damages. Depending on the severity of the incident, compensation can also be granted for future income loss.

When filing a claim it is important to provide accurate information regarding the incident. This includes the date the location, weather and water conditions as well as the scene. It is also essential to note any eyewitness accounts and their contact details. If you can, also take pictures of the scene of the accident including any injuries, damages and the boats involved.

To receive compensation for an injury, the person must be able to prove three elements. They must first demonstrate that the person responsible for their actions owed them an obligation of care. They must then prove that the negligent party breached their duty of care by acting recklessly or negligently. Then, they have to prove that the breach caused injury to them.
